Oatmeal Butterscotch Cookies

Chewy Oatmeal Butterscotch Cookies filled with rich butterscotch and hearty oats, offering a delightful and nostalgic flavor.

  • Total Time: 27 minutes
  • Yield: 24 cookies

Ingredients

  • 2 cups old-fashioned oats
  • 1 cup butterscotch chips
  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up brown sugar
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
  • Pinch of salt

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, beat together but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until creamy.
  3. Add eggs one at a time, mixing until fully incorporated. Stir in vanilla extract.
  4. In another bowl, combine fl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t.
  5. Gradually mix the dry ingredients into the wet mixture until just combined.
  6. Fold in oats and butterscotch chips until evenly distributed.
  7. Drop tablespoonfuls of dough onto baking sheet, spacing them out as they will spread.
  8. Bake for 10-12 minutes until edges are golden but centers are soft.
  9. C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ack.

Notes

Chilling the dough for 30 minutes enhances flavor and texture. Rotate baking sheets halfway through for even baking.
